Introduction to Potassium Hydroxide

Potassium hydroxide (KOH) is a white, solid, highly corrosive substance. It is highly soluble in water, which makes it useful for various applications. KOH is produced through the electrolysis of potassium chloride (KCl) and is a key component in the manufacture of soap, glass, and paper. Its strong alkaline properties also make it useful in the production of biodiesel, where it acts as a catalyst.

Uses of Potassium Hydroxide in Household Products

Potassium hydroxide is used in a variety of household products due to its ability to dissolve fats, oils, and waxes. Some of the most common household products that contain potassium hydroxide include:

  • Drain cleaners: Potassium hydroxide is used in drain cleaners to dissolve grease and other blockages in pipes.
  • Soap and body care products: KOH is used in the production of soap, shampoo, and other body care products due to its ability to create a rich lather and clean the skin effectively.

Safety Precautions

While potassium hydroxide is useful in household products, it can also pose significant health risks if not handled properly. It is essential to wear protective clothing, including gloves and goggles, when handling products that contain KOH. Prolonged exposure to potassium hydroxide can cause severe burns, eye damage, and respiratory problems. In case of accidental exposure, it is crucial to rinse the affected area with plenty of water and seek medical attention immediately.
